High-Risk Corridors
US-160, US-550, and Camino del Rio
Durango's rideshare conflict points gather where the two US highways meet and where in-town traffic is thickest: US-160 and US-550 as they cross the city, the Camino del Rio commercial corridor that carries both routes through town, Main Avenue, and Colorado Highway 3. This is mountain country, so winter ice, snowpack, and steep grades turn into real crash factors that shape how fault gets argued. Knowing these roads tells us which camera systems and traffic records may exist to show what actually happened.
